What "AI" actually is (no jargon) +

"AI" is a buzzword that means almost nothing on its own. What matters is a large language model like Claude — it reads words the way you do, runs them through a giant brain of everything it's learned, and predicts what should come next. Same as you deciding what to say based on what you know.

It's flexible, not a calculator — ask the same thing twice and you might get two slightly different answers. That flexibility is the point. The trick is pointing it at the right work so the results are reliable.

The three buckets of every business +

Every business does three things, and AI can help with all three:

  • Get attention — networking, referrals, social, outreach, ads.
  • Convert attention — your sales process, proposals, follow-up.
  • Deliver — onboarding, the work itself, getting paid, collecting reviews.

Your first AI workflow should attack the most painful, repetitive task inside one of these buckets. That's where it pays off fastest.

Claude vs. Claude Code — the difference that matters +

Claude in a chat window is a brilliant assistant behind glass. Great for quick answers, but it can't reach into your business and do things.

Claude Code is that same intelligence living inside your computer with hands. It reads your files, builds documents and web pages, connects to your other software, and does real work for you. It runs inside a free workshop called VS Code. It looks intimidating for about ten minutes — then it just looks like an employee who never sleeps. You're not becoming a programmer. You're the one telling the programmer what to build.

What a real workday looks like +

With simple plain-English instructions, in about five minutes each, Claude Code can:

  • Turn a voice memo into a week of social posts with images.
  • Build a branded, signable proposal page with the price and deposit built in.
  • Research local networking events, referral partners, or speaking gigs — with links and contacts.
  • Spin up a landing page in your brand colors (like this one).
  • Generate a clean report or dashboard from raw data.

You can run several at once. At that point the limit isn't how much AI can do — it's how much you can pay attention to.
